Kathryn Rew and Daniel Thomas, pupils at Rendcomb College presented Sarah James with a cheque for a staggering £2404.23 for the local charity, the James Hopkins Trust, based in Gloucester. It is a charity which provides practical help for severely disabled, life threatened and life limited young children with nursing needs, aged 5 years and under living in Gloucestershire.
